This document specifies the methods of examining the knowledge and skill set of the PE-welder required to carry out on-site weldable joint casing connections on thermally insulated rigid single and twin pipe systems for directly buried hot and cold water networks according to EN 13941-1 [7] and EN 13941-2 [8] also as for flexible pipe systems according to EN 15632-1 [10], EN 15632-2 [11], EN 15632-3 [12], EN 15632-4 [13], EN 17414-1 [17], EN 17414-2 [18], EN 17414-3 [19], EN 17878-1 [23], EN 17878-2 [24], EN 17878-3 [25] and CEN/TS 17889 [26].
The application of these specifications ensures that the examination is carried out according to a standardised examining procedure.
This document applies to the following processes:
- preparatory works for joint casing assembly;
- assembling and testing the elements for surveillance systems;
- assembling weldable joint casing system;
- executing hot gas welding and hot gas extrusion welding
- verifying joint tightness (leak-tightness testing);
- thermally insulating the joint casing (PUR foaming or half-shell);
- sealing fill & vent openings (weldable plugs);
- assessing overall installation quality of the completed welded joint casing assembly and on-site welded component (non-destructive);
Requirements for test institutes and supervisors are also specified.
NOTE Due to differences of the specific application methods and equipment from joint casing system suppliers, it might be advisable for the PE-welder to be certified for the particular weldable joint casing system.
